Can an Administrator judge a situation involving their own clan?
No. An Administrator must be aware, at all times, of any situation that could become a ‘conflict of interest’. To prevent any conflict of interest, no Administrator may be involved in a situation that involves their own clan. This allows our Admin to have fun and play in matches, but prevents any problems. If, at any time, a player believes an Administrator is in a ‘conflict of interest’, they should contact the IGL Commissioner or if he does not respond within 48hrs, then the IGL Owner. Full details of the situation must be provided. We will not start investigating an Administrator just becomes somebody ‘thinks’ or ‘believes’ an Administrator is in a conflict of interest. There has to be justification for an investigation.
